Understanding Mold And Mildew Development Factors



The key aspect adding to mold growth is wetness. Mold and mildew spores require moisture to sprout and thrive, making humid or wet atmospheres highly vulnerable to mold infestations.


Post Mold Remediation ReportPost Remediation Mold Testing Near Me
One more considerable variable is temperature. Mold often tends to proliferate in temperature levels in between 77 to 86 levels Fahrenheit, although it can still grow in a broader variety. Additionally, mold and mildew requires organic matter to eat. This can include different structure materials such as insulation, drywall, and wood. Consistently inspecting and maintaining these materials can help stop mold and mildew development.


Additionally, air flow and light exposure can impact mold development. Areas that do not have correct ventilation and all-natural light are a lot more susceptible to mold development. By addressing these elements thoroughly, individuals can properly reduce mold and mildew growth and guard their living atmospheres.


Appropriate Mold And Mildew Cleansing Methods



Using effective cleaning methods is crucial in resolving and avoiding the reoccurrence of mold and mildew contamination in interior settings. When handling mold, it is essential to focus on safety by using safety gear such as handwear covers, masks, and safety glasses. The primary step in correct mold cleansing is to contain the afflicted area to stop the spread of spores to unpolluted areas. This can be accomplished by sealing the area and using air scrubbers or adverse air makers to keep air high quality.

Next, complete cleansing of surfaces is required to eliminate mold and mildew growth properly. Non-porous materials can usually be cleansed with a cleaning agent solution and scrubbing, while porous materials might need a lot more extensive methods such as HEPA vacuuming or removal and substitute. It is necessary to dry out the cleaned up area completely to avoid mold re-growth. After cleansing, using antimicrobial services can help inhibit mold growth and avoid future contamination. Routine assessments and maintenance are also important to catch any mold problems early and address them promptly. By following these appropriate mold and mildew cleaning strategies, you can make sure a mold-free and healthy and balanced interior atmosphere.

Using All-natural Remediation Solutions



After successfully implementing dampness control procedures to avoid mold and mildew growth in interior atmospheres, home owners can currently check out the efficiency of natural removal solutions in preserving a healthy living area. All-natural remediation remedies utilize eco-friendly techniques to combat mold and mildew and mold, making them a mold removal at home preferred option for those looking for safe choices. One such solution is using vinegar, a natural antimicrobial agent, to tidy and disinfect surface areas contaminated by mold. Just thin down vinegar with water and spray it onto the impacted locations, enabling it to sit for a few hours before wiping tidy. Additionally, tea tree oil, understood for its antifungal buildings, can be blended with water and sprayed onto mold-infested surface areas to prevent additional development. An additional natural option is hydrogen peroxide, which can efficiently kill mold and mildew on numerous surfaces without leaving harmful deposits behind.
